Boxpirates Wiki >>> PI Webserver nginx

Aus Boxpirates Wiki
Wechseln zu: Navigation, Suche

Installation Nginx

Auf dem kleinen Wunderwerk, alias Raspberry Pi, läuft auch ein Webserver. Ich probierte den klassischen Apache 2 aus, wobei die Performance für mich nicht zufriedenstellend war. Somit entschied ich mich den Nginx Webserver zu installieren, welcher wesentlich runder läuft. Im Folgenden beschreibe ich, wie ihr diesen auf eurem Raspberry Pi installiert und einrichtet.

Voraussetzung: Raspbian oder vergleichbare Distribution installiert

Schritt 1

Die Installation geht dank dem Paketmanager APT denkbar einfach.

sudo apt-get install nginx

Schritt 2

Nun passen wir noch ein paar Werte bzgl. max. Prozesse an, so dass Nginx den Raspberry Pi nicht überlastet.

sudo sed -i "s/worker_processes 4;/worker_processes 1;/g" /etc/nginx/nginx.conf

sudo sed -i "s/worker_connections 768;/worker_connections 128;/g" /etc/nginx/nginx.conf

Schritt 3

Jetzt noch Ngix starten, damit er auch einen Nutzen hat

sudo /etc/init.d/nginx start

Und das war’s schon.

Fertig ist der Nginx installiert.

Nun kann PHP (ich empfehle php5-fpm zu verwenden) und eine MySQL Datenbank wie unter jedem gewöhnlichen Debian Server nachinstalliert werden.

Ebenfalls ist es möglich (siehe weiter unten) Ruby on Rails zu installieren.